Terminology
Admin Configuration — The Admin Configuration portal provides access to all Marigold Engage modules and allows you to configure permissions, add user accounts and more. You can access this area when you first log into the Marigold Engage portal, or from any module by selecting from the drop-down list in the upper right corner under the User's login name.
Content — This term describes template, email message, web page, mobile push notification or SMS content
Data selection — Marigold Engage applications allow you to create sub-selections of data from your data sources, referred to as Data Selections, to use for filtering message audiences and for routing audience members through your marketing journeys.
Library — Tree view of folders and subfolders where uploaded images are stored that can be reused in Marigold Engage content, such as emails, web pages, and push notifications.
MTA — Mail Transport Assembly. This is the engine that sends email blasts from Marigold Engage.
Message — Basic email message that can be edited by the user and then sent as a single email blast to an audience list, or used in a marketing journey.
Page — Web page that has been designed using the Content module in Marigold Engage. Pages can be used in journeys when you want to redirect the contact to a form or other website.
Published — Content that is ready to be sent or used in a journey. Content such as messages, pages, notifications, can be sent using marketing journeys or via APIs. Content must be saved, validated and published before it can be sent through a journey. Content may also required approval before publication, if the organization has Approval Management enabled. Changes can be made to published content, but the changes will only be visible when the content is published again.
Push notification — A push notification is an unsolicited message sent to a user. These notifications are usually short text messages and are sent to users who have opted in to receive them or who are currently using an application that is sending the notification. Marigold Engage allows you to create mobile push notifications that include personalized user data and emojis.
Placeholder — Section in a template that is modifiable by the message creator who is using the template in a journey.
Template — A predefined message layout with predefined content that can be used by email message designers. Templates use a content locking mechanism to limit the fields a message designer can modify or add in the message before publishing and sending it.
